#838b38 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#838b38 is composed of 51.4% red, 54.5% green and 22%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 5.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 59.7% yellow and 45.5% black. It has a hue angle of 65.8 degrees, a saturation of 42.6% and a lightness of 38.2%. #838b38 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ff70 with #071700. Closest websafe color is: #999933.

Shades and Tints of #838b38

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0c0d05 is the darkest color, while #fffffe is the lightest one.

Tones of #838b38

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#65665e is the less saturated color, while #adc003 is the most saturated one.
